Antenna Menu

Figure 9

Select Antenna to perform the functions listed below.

Memorize

For Antenna A or Antenna B

Select either Air (when used with an indoor/outdoor
antenna) or Cable (when used with direct cable) then
press ENT(er) to start the automatic channel memorization
process.

For Antenna DTV

Select Air when used with an indoor/outdoor antenna.
Select Cable or Cable (HRC) when used with Direct cable.

There are three types of Cable systems: Standard, IRC

and HRC. To memorize Standard or IRC, select Cable; to
memorize HRC, select Cable (HRC).

Check with your Cable company to determine which type
of Cable system they use. If your cable company cannot
advise you, select Cable.

To stop the automatic channel memorization process,

press CANCEL. Channels memorized before you pressed

CANCEL are retained in memory.

After memorizing channels, the channels in the memory

can be accessed in ascending or descending order or by
pressing CH or .

Antenna Menu

The following Antenna Menu options are available for use on Antenna A, Antenna B or Antenna DTV. You can memorize

channels, add or delete channels, and add channels to an SQV (Super Quick View™) list. For Antenna A and Anenna B,
you can name channels.

Antenna Menu: Antenna, Memorize Channels, Channel,
Memory and Name

Channel

For additional Channel editing, press ADJUST or
to select the channel or press CH or for channels
already in memory.

On Antenna DTV, when the broadcaster has sent a virtual
channel number, the virtual channel number is shown
in the text box and the original digital channel is shown

below on-screen, as a reference.

Memory

After the available channels have been memorized with

Memorize, weaker channels viewed with Antenna A
or Antenna B can be added. Unwanted channels for

Antenna A, Antenna B, or Antenna DTV can also be

deleted. Press CH or on the remote control to see
the channels in memory. Press ADJUST or to select

Added or Deleted for the channel shown in the Channel

number box.

Name

Channels shown on Antenna A or Antenna B can be

named (up to four characters). After you enter a name, it
will appear on the TV screen, next to the channel number.

1. Press ADJUST or to select each letter.

2. Press ENT(er) to set the letter and move to the

next letter position.

3. Press CANCEL to move back one position.

Channels on Antenna DTV are automatically named, if the

broadcaster sends the information
